UNITeS again named finalist in Stockholm Challenge - June 2002UNITeS has been selected as a finalist in the Stockholm Challenge for the second year in a row. The Stockholm Challenge is a non-profit initiative of the City of Stockholm, Sweden, and a unique awards program for pioneering ICT projects world wide. The Stockholm Challenge focuses on the positive effects of today's information society, and the benefit information and communication technology can bring people and society. The technology itself is not the issue. Its web site notes, "The Stockholm Challenge is not only a competition, but a meeting place for people who share a vision about the future. The big challenge is to bridge the digital divide." 101 ICT Projects from 40 countries around the world were selected finalists for 2002. Most of the finalists come from the US, with 16, India with 11 and Sweden with 10. Other countries, representing the world-wide dissemination are Lithuania, Czechia, Nepal, United Arab Emirates, Zimbabwe, South Korea and Cuba. There are 20 other finalists in the same category, Education, as UNITeS. The winners in each category will be announced and celebrated in September 2002.
